About This Book

At the busy county fair, Pup tries to sneak away and hide from Hound, leading to a playful game of hide and seek. Young readers will enjoy the lively adventure as the two dogs explore the fairgrounds together. This simple story celebrates friendship and fun moments in a familiar setting.

Why we rated Pup and Hound Lost and Found (Kids Can Read) 6C

Pup and Hound Lost and Found (Kids Can Read) is written at a Level 1-2 reading level across 32 pages (approximately 295 words). Strong independent readers around grade 2.7 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, Pup and Hound Lost and Found (Kids Can Read) works for readers up to grade 3.7.

Read aloud, Pup and Hound Lost and Found (Kids Can Read) takes about 2 minutes, which fits within a single read-aloud session.

We rate Pup and Hound Lost and Found (Kids Can Read) as 6C ("Clear") because the content sits in the "Gentle" range — no conflict beyond everyday childhood experiences.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ly gentle; no single dimension stands out as a concern.

No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the gentle intensity score.

Thematically, Pup and Hound Lost and Found (Kids Can Read) explores friendship, dogs, and social issues - lost & found —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
